Book a flight online and save money with these tips

Whether you need to travel to another city or another country, booking a flight has never been easier. There are many options for travelers. The airlines themselves offer reservation services through the internet, telephone and in person. There are also cheap travel sites that simplify the whole process by allowing you to compare all the fares from each airline at once and choose which one best suits your preferences.

There are many things to consider when booking a flight: departure city, departure date, arrival city, arrival date, whether or not you want a round trip, number of nights you will be in your destination, if you want or not booking a rental car and/or hotel along with the flight, etc. Fortunately, all of this is made easy with the use of online search and comparison tools. You can experiment with the dates and times as well as the destinations to get an idea of ​​the price range. The more flexible you are, the easier it will be to get a cheaper price.

Age is also an important factor, especially if you are traveling with children or the elderly. Ticket prices are different for adults and children under 17 years of age. For seniors, senior discounts may be available. While credit/debit cards are the main payment methods preferred by the airline industry, there are some airlines that accept PayPal and unused travel funds. You may also have flyer points or gift cards that you can redeem.

Price alerts will help you book a flight

Be sure to sign up for price alerts before you book a flight. Tickets can fluctuate considerably, even on a daily basis. Even a small decrease can result in big savings if you have to buy tickets for family members or associates. Some sites and online tools even allow you to set your own budget and will notify you when a ticket becomes available within your budget range.

Determine whether or not it would be cheaper to book a long-haul flight yourself. If you’re flying a long haul, consider that it might be cheaper to book two or three legs of the trip separately by adding one or two more destinations to the trip. For example, if you need to fly from Europe to Alaska, it might be cheaper to book a trip to Atlanta first, then book a trip from Atlanta to Chicago, then fly from Chicago to Seattle, and finally to Alaska using budget airlines. offering smaller trips.
